Comments (14)Yep - it’s just a very good all round paint. It’s in our bedroom and en-suite too. I like it because it is a very flat matt. (We have Little Greene Intelligent Matt in our main bathroom, but only because i likes a particular colour). Mylands is expensive - slightly more than Farrow and Ball, however I always buy from Paint Depot online who are a tad cheaper and usually have an extra 10% offer too. Comments (11)Slaked Lime by Little Green is nice. I’ve used it on a couple of bookcases in eggshell. Much as I like it, it is not hardwearing at all and it has chipped a lot. One wall emulsion I recently used is Dulux Diamond Trade paint as it is tough. No scuffs or scrapes yet! Very tough paint.
